A traditional Maori method of cooking food using heated rocks buried in a pit oven. Meats and vegetables are cooked slowly in the earth oven, giving them a unique smoky flavor.

Auckland is generally safe, with low levels of violent crime. However, petty crime like pickpocketing can occur in tourist areas.
